History of the Game. It is believed 3 card poker was invented in 1994 by Derek Webb. This game had a different name before and was called by other names that are Brit-Brag and Casino Brag. Webb applied to patents and was granted patents in the United States. After this, he began marketing Prime Table Games 3 card poker.
